Do I need to apply Child Dependent Visa before ILR?

Post by sherlypk » Mon Sep 21, 2009 11:34 am

Hi,

I am about to apply for ILR soon our baby born in UK but since we didn't go out of the country, I didn't apply his dependent visa.

Please inform whether it is ok to apply for ILR without having dependent visa on his passport or do I need to apply for his dependet visa first before ILR application.

thanks.

Hi Sherlypk,

You can apply for your ILR with your son without a dependant visa.

As you said, there was no reason to apply for a dependant visa if the child never travelled out of the UK.

This scenario has been discussed many times in the forum.

if you are planning to apply for BC to your baby then you don’t need to add his/her application for ILR ( can save some money )
instead once you get your ILR you can apply your baby for naturalization.
